Top 5 Strain Wave Telescope Mounts

ZWO AM5N Side View

Five Strain Wave Harmonic Mounts Strain wave harmonic drive technology has transformed telescope mounts by virtually eliminating backlash and providing ultra-smooth, high-precision tracking. This is especially crucial for long-exposure astrophotography, where even minute tracking errors can compromise image quality.
